NASDAQ: XRX
Xerox Holdings Corp Stock Ownership - Who owns Xerox Holdings?

Insider buying vs selling

Have Xerox Holdings Corp insiders been buying or selling?

Buy
Sell
NameRoleDateSharesPriceValue
Louis PastorPresident and Chief Operating Officer2026-01-0429,452$2.46
$72.45kSell
Steven John BandrowczakCEO2025-08-0227,837$3.94
$109.68kSell
A. Scott LetierDirector2025-08-0129,600$3.95
$116.92kBuy
Mirlanda GecajCFO2025-08-015,179$4.03
$20.87kBuy
Mirlanda GecajCFO2025-07-20523$5.07
$2.65kSell
Mirlanda GecajCFO2025-05-2310,000$4.41
$44.10kBuy
Steven John BandrowczakCEO2025-05-2322,300$4.48
$99.90kBuy
John G. BrunoPresident and COO2025-05-2325,000$4.38
$109.50kBuy
A. Scott LetierDirector2025-05-2325,000$4.43
$110.75kBuy
Mirlanda GecajCFO2025-03-112,293$6.11
$14.01kSell

1 of 2

XRX insiders have sold more... subscribe to Premium to read more.
Net Insider Buy/Sell (L12M) Ownership

Be the first to know when XRX insiders and whales buy or sell their stock.

XRX Shareholders

What type of owners hold Xerox Holdings Corp stock?

Institutional
Insider
Retail
NameHoldSharesValueType
Carl C. Icahn67.53%86,470,636$235.20MInsider
Blackrock Inc8.59%10,993,525$29.90MInstitution
Vanguard Group Inc8.12%10,397,351$28.28MInstitution
Darwin Deason6.67%8,542,085$23.23MInsider
Dimensional Fund Advisors LP5.11%6,540,519$17.79MInstitution
State Street Corp3.44%4,401,031$11.97MInstitution
Marshall Wace LLP2.97%3,801,550$10.34MInstitution
Paradigm Capital Management Inc2.73%3,491,200$9.50MInstitution
Charles Schwab Investment Management Inc2.07%2,644,113$7.19MInstitution
Two Sigma Investments LP1.93%2,476,689$6.74MInstitution

1 of 3

XRX vs Information Technology Service Stocks

TickerInst. %Insider %Net Insider (L12M)Net Insider (L3M)
XRX48.35%51.65%Net SellingNet Selling
TSSI32.61%29.47%Net SellingNet Selling
CNDT63.97%36.03%Net BuyingNet Selling
III31.83%68.17%Net SellingNet Selling
UIS78.57%12.15%Net Selling

Xerox Holdings Stock Ownership FAQ

Who owns Xerox Holdings?

Xerox Holdings (NASDAQ: XRX) is owned by 78.93% institutional shareholders, 84.32% Xerox Holdings insiders, and 0.00% retail investors. Carl C. Icahn is the largest individual Xerox Holdings shareholder, owning 86.47M shares representing 67.53% of the company. Carl C. Icahn's Xerox Holdings shares are currently valued at $235.20M.

If you're new to stock investing, here's how to buy Xerox Holdings stock.
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.